Battery Management Analog Devices, Inc. LTC3305IFE Overview
The LTC3305IFE, designed and manufactured by Analog Devices, Inc., is a specialized integrated circuit for battery management, particularly tailored for lead acid battery systems. This component ensures efficient balancing and management of multicell battery stacks, crucial for maintaining longevity and reliability in battery-dependent applications. By leveraging advanced battery management technology, the LTC3305IFE plays a pivotal role in optimizing performance and extending the operational life of lead acid batteries, making it an essential choice for serious industrial applications.
LTC3305IFE Features
The LTC3305IFE offers several distinctive features that make it a standout choice for battery management systems. Key features include its ability to independently balance up to four lead acid batteries simultaneously, enhancing the overall battery efficiency and life cycle. It operates without the need for an external power supply, which minimizes the system's power consumption and simplifies the circuit design. Additionally, its compact 38-TSSOP package allows for space-efficient designs in complex electronic systems.
